Stroud — 2017

David Drew (Labour Party) was elected with 29,994 votes47.0% of 63,816 valid votes. Under First Past the Post, a plurality is enough; a majority is not required.

1David Drew Labour Party 29,99447.0%−3.0 ptsElected
2Neil Carmichael Conservative Party 29,30745.9%
3Max Wilkinson Liberal Democrats 2,0533.2%
4Sarah Lunnon Green Party 1,4232.2%
5Glenville Gogerly UK Independence Party 1,0391.6%

Electorate 82,839 · Turnout 77.0% · Majority 687 · Back to 2017 overview
